WebWhat Is Inclusion in the Workplace? Inclusion in the workplace creates a sense of belonging among co-workers that can translate to greater productivity, more innovation, and better decision-making. Team performance improves when employees feel more connected.

WebSocial Inclusion. Social inclusion is the process of improving the terms on which individuals and groups take part in society—improving the ability, opportunity, and dignity of those disadvantaged on the basis of their identity. In every country, some groups confront barriers that prevent them from fully participating in political, economic ...
